Surah Saffat Ayat 39 in Arabic Text
English Translation
Here you can read various translations of verse 39
And you will not be recompensed except for what you used to do –
But it will be no more than the retribution of (the Evil) that ye have wrought;-
You will only be recompensed according to your deeds.”
And you will be requited nothing except for what you used to do (evil deeds, sins, and Allah’s disobedience which you used to do in this world);
Ye are requited naught save what ye did –
And in no way will you be recompensed, except according to whatever you were doing.
and be repaid only according to your deeds.’
